Blaine Perkins, the 20-year-old who won three ARCA Menards Series West races last season and finished second to Jesse Love in the championship points standings, will take his talents to the NASCAR Xfinity Series on a limited basis in 2021.
The Bakersfield, California, native will race the No. 03 Chevrolet Camaro for Our Motorsports in the Xfinity Series, the team and the driver announced Monday.

Fox Sports reported Perkins will compete in six Xfinity Series races for Our Motorsports as series regular Brett Moffitt’s teammate. Perkins’ debut in the series will come at Martinsville Speedway on April 9.
Perkins, who ran the full schedule for Bob Bruncati’s Sunrise Ford Racing team in the West Series last season, has not yet announced ARCA Menards plans for 2021.
Including his three wins (Utah Motorsports Campus, Evergreen Speedway and Douglas County Speedway), Perkins earned eight top-fives and nine top 10s in 11 West Series races last year.
Perkins participated in last weekend’s ARCA Menards Series test at Daytona International Speedway as part of the series’ Road to Daytona program. He drove the No. 01 Fast Track Racing Toyota on Day 1 of the two-day test.
